身为一位机械工程师,需频繁运用Linux及Windows指令。尽管两者皆属命令行工具范畴,却在具体实践过程中有诸多差异性。以下,本人愿意分享关于Linux指令以及Windows指令的心得体会。
命令行的魅力
作为操作系统核心交互方式之一,命令行允许用户直面计算机内核,执行各种任务,被誉为“神奇的魔杖”。于我而言,无论是在Linux还是Windows环境下,常用于管理文件和目录的ls、cd、cp及mv命令都是得力助手,毫无疑问它们极大提升了文件列表查看、目录切换、文件复制/移动的效率。尽管命令名称略有差异,但其基本功能都是为用户提供便捷的文件管理服务。
实践证明,Linux命令比Windows命令更为强大且具有更高的灵活性。例如,Linux系统支持多个命令的合并执行,通过管道符号"|"即可实现,这是复杂操作的有效手段。同时,利用Linux中的通配符,我们可对大量文件进行高效批量处理。虽然这种功能在Windows系统中有相应的解决方案,但可能不如前者便捷。因此,对于需要频繁操作的任务,我会优先选择在Linux环境下完成,因其能更精确满足我的需求。
文件系统的差异
除了命令行工具的差异之外,Linux与Windows系统之间还体现在文件系统方面。Linux系统中的“一切皆为文件”理念被充分融入,包括硬件设备及目录均以文件形式呈现。此类设计使得Linux系统显得更为协调精炼,易于掌握应用。然而,对比来看,尽管Windows系统中存在文件系统抽象概念linux查看磁盘空间,却并未完全实践“一切皆为文件”的原则,这可能使部分用户在处理文件与目录时,偏向选择Linux系统,因其更贴近其固有的思维模式。
另外值得注意的是,Linux使用正斜杠"/"作为文件路径分隔符,而Windows则使用反斜杠"",这是我在两种操作系统之间切换时需留意到的微妙差异。尽管在Windows环境中会因分隔符不同而产生路径误判,但是经过多次实践和反思,我已经能够自如地应对这种差异,使得工作效率得到明显提高。
系统管理的体验
针对系统管理,相较于Windows系统,Linux具有更强的开放性与灵活性。借助用于远程控制与调整的命令行工具,如ps查询实时系统进程,top监控系统性能状况,以及crontab实现定时任务的设置等,使得在Linux环境中进行系统管理变得更为高效便捷,帮助我们更好地掌握整个系统的运行状况和性能表现。
相较而言,Windows的系统管理功能或许略显复杂。尽管Windows也配备了界面化的管理工具,然而我会偏好使用命令行工具来执行各类任务。在Windows环境中,我会借助如netstat及tasklist这样的命令来获取详细的网络状况与进程信息,尽管操作体验不如Linux流畅,但仍能满足我的日常需要。
网络操作的便利
Linux系统的网络操作实力卓越。借助命令行工具,如ifconfig获取网络接口信息,ping检测网络连接状况,以及ssh实现远程访问,我能游刃有余地进行网络配置、故障诊断及监测。这使我在Linux环境下更为高效地处理各类网络问题。
尽管Windows系统配备了必要的网络指令如ipconfig和pinglinux命令windows命令,然而在应对复杂网络问题时linux命令windows命令,相较于其他系统仍显不足。在实际工作中,我们更倾向于运用Linux系统来执行精准的网络诊断并迅速找到问题所在,从而高效地完成任务。
安全性与稳定性
在确保系统稳定及安全性方面,首选Linux系统是明智之选。作为开源的领军角色,它拥有庞大的开发群体,适时地修复和更新安全补丁。而反观Windows,封闭的特性常常会引发安全风险,因此我们需尽快安装官方发布的更新以保障系统安然无恙。
此外,Linux系统在保持系统稳定性上具备明显优势。即使经历长期运行与高负荷测试,Linux系统仍能维持稳定可靠,极少出现卡顿或崩溃事故。为此,我对Linux系统倍感信赖,更倾向于选择Linux环境以确保关键任务及重要数据的安全。
学习与成长
在反复运用Linux与Windows指令后,我的技艺得到精进linux学习论坛,领悟诸多实用知识。历经实践,逐步形成独特的工作方式与理论体系,使得面临的挑战及问题得以有效解决。这些简洁而富有智慧的指令行工具,让我深感计算机科学的迷人之处。
在未来职业道路上,我将持续深耕Linux与Windows命令知识领域,以进一步提高自身技术素养及问题解决能力。作为工作中必备的利器,命令行工具不仅是引领我前进的动力源泉,也是我可靠的技术支持。我坚信,通过不懈努力与实践,定能在技术道路上稳步前行,取得更为辉煌的成就。